Milan have been linked with several strikers this summer, but instead they decided to renew Zlatan Ibrahimovic’s contract. As long as he stays fit, the Swede will start every game, removing the need of a striker.
According to Spanish outlet AS, the Rossoneri are one of the teams that are interested in Luka Jovic. The 22-year-old’s adventure at Real Madrid has been far from easy and Zinedine Zidane has now advised him to leave on loan this season.
During a meeting, which took place a few days ago, the manager explained why a loan move will be for the best. However, it might not be that easy for the Serbian to secure a loan, with little time left of the transfer window.
Chelsea expressed their interest a while back but ended up signing Timo Werner, while the likes of Napoli (Victor Oshimen) and Monaco (Kevin Volland) also have made their signings already. That leaves Milan, although they did renew Ibrahimovic’s contract.
Out of the known options, therefore, the Rossoneri are in pole position but the position isn’t a priority for them. Lorenzo Colombo, the Primavera product, did well during pre-season and could be a good backup for the 38-year-old.
